About this school

Bridgestone Es is a State/Public serving middle age pupils, located in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ma County. The school has 411 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Western Heights school district. It serves grades 5โ€“6 in an urban setting. The school employs 24.6 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 16.7:1. 3% are proficient in maths. Free & reduced-price lunch

384 of the school's 411 students (93%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.

School district: WESTERN HEIGHTS

Bridgestone Es is one of 8 schools in WESTERN HEIGHTS, based in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. The district serves 2,828 students district-wide and employs 177 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 411 students, Bridgestone Es is larger than the district average of about 354 students per school.
